Understanding Hip Dysplasia: Explanation and Growth

Hip dysplasia is a frequent and intricate developmental condition impacting the hip joints of dogs. It happens when the hip joint does not fit properly into the hip socket, causing instability. This deformity can result from a combination of hereditary elements, external conditions, and rapid growth rates during puppyhood. Specific dog breeds, especially larger ones, are more susceptible to this condition.

The onset of hip dysplasia typically starts early in life, with symptoms frequently manifesting as the dog matures. In certain cases, the condition can advance to osteoarthritis, causing further complications. Proper nutrition, controlled exercise, and weight management play key roles in lowering the threats associated with hip dysplasia. Early diagnosis and intervention can significantly boost a dog's quality of life, highlighting the importance of regular veterinary check-ups. Understanding this condition's nature is crucial for dog owners to ensure their pets get appropriate care.

Frequent Indicators of Hip Dysplasia

While many dogs may first present no signs, frequent signs of hip dysplasia often become evident as they mature. Dogs experiencing this condition may exhibit a noticeable decrease in engagement in physical activities, leading to reluctance to engage in play or exercise. Owners might observe a characteristic "bunny hop" gait, where the dog moves both hind legs simultaneously rather than alternating them. Lameness or stiffness, notably after periods of rest, can also be indicative of the condition.

Additionally, dogs may have difficulty rising from a lying position or show signs of pain when climbing stairs or jumping. Weight gain can develop due to decreased mobility, further exacerbating joint issues. Changes in behavior, such as irritability or withdrawal, may also emerge as dogs experience pain. Recognizing these symptoms early can be vital for timely intervention and management of hip dysplasia, ultimately improving the dog's quality of life.

What Breeds Are at Increased Risk for Hip Dysplasia?

Many canine breeds are predisposed to hip dysplasia because of genetic factors and their physical structure. Large and giant breeds, such as German Shepherds, Golden Retrievers, Rottweilers, and St. Bernards, are exceptionally vulnerable. These dogs often have a combination of weight and skeletal conformation that puts additional pressure on their hip joints.

Mid-sized varieties such as Bulldogs and Boxers also experience greater risk, as their distinctive body structures can result in hip joint malformation. Furthermore, certain small breeds, including Dachshunds and Cocker Spaniels, may suffer from hip dysplasia, though not as often than larger breeds.

Comprehending breed predisposition is essential for dog owners and breeders alike, as it emphasizes the importance of conscientious breeding methods and early discovery. Periodic veterinary examinations can help spot health risks before they progress, maintaining a healthier life for these at-risk breeds.

Genetics and Surroundings: Important Factors in Hip Dysplasia

Understanding the interplay between hereditary factors and environment is crucial in addressing hip dysplasia in dogs. The condition is significantly influenced by genetic factors, with certain breeds predisposed to developing hip dysplasia due to inherited traits. Genetic mutations affecting joint formation can lead to improper development, raising the likelihood of hip dysplasia.

Environmental conditions also take a important component. Obesity, for example, places additional stress on a dog's hips, amplifying the probability of dysplasia. In addition, inadequate nutrition during growth phases can give rise to bone abnormalities. Overexertion during early developmental stages, particularly in large breeds, can further contribute to joint problems.

Ultimately, a combination of genetics and environmental factors creates a multifaceted risk profile for hip dysplasia. Understanding these variables allows pet owners and breeders to make informed decisions, potentially lessening the frequency of this debilitating condition in dogs.

Surgical Approaches for Care

Surgical intervention provides a variety of choices for dogs suffering from hip dysplasia, designed to alleviating pain and improving mobility. The most common procedures comprise femoral head ostectomy (FHO) and total hip replacement (THR). FHO entails extracting the femoral head, enabling the body to form a false joint, which can reduce pain. Total hip replacement, on the other hand, substitutes the entire hip joint with a prosthetic, leading to better function and reduced discomfort. Another alternative is the triple pelvic osteotomy (TPO), which realigns the hip socket to better accommodate the femur. The selection of procedure relies on the dog's age, severity of dysplasia, and overall health, demanding thoughtful evaluation by veterinary professionals to ensure ideal outcomes.

Medicine and Pain Reduction

Managing hip dysplasia effectively in dogs typically involves a combination of medications and pain relief strategies aimed at enhancing quality of life. NSAIDs are commonly prescribed to reduce inflammation and alleviate pain, which allows for improved mobility. Veterinarians may sometimes advise glucosamine and chondroitin supplements to maintain joint health and function. Corticocopyrights might also be employed for their anti-inflammatory properties, although they pose potential side effects if used long-term. Pain management may further involve opioids for more severe discomfort. Close monitoring and tweaks to medication types and dosages are important, as individual responses can differ widely among dogs, ensuring ideal care and comfort throughout the treatment process.

Lifestyle and Recovery Approaches

Lifestyle and rehabilitation strategies play an essential role in managing hip dysplasia in dogs. Regular, controlled exercise helps maintain muscle strength and joint flexibility, reducing discomfort. Low-impact activities, such as swimming and walking on soft surfaces, are particularly beneficial. Weight management is vital; maintaining a healthy body condition can alleviate stress on the hips. Additionally, physical therapy techniques, including massage and stretching, can enhance mobility and improve overall quality of life. Joint products, like glucosamine and omega-3 fatty acids, may also support joint health. Providing a comfortable resting area, using orthopedic beds, and avoiding excessive jumping or stair climbing further contribute to a dog's well-being. Together, these strategies foster a more active, pain-free lifestyle for dogs suffering from hip dysplasia.

Is Hip Dysplasia Possible to Be Detected Via a Blood Analysis?

Hip dysplasia cannot be identified via a blood test. Determining the condition generally includes physical exams, clinical history, and imaging procedures such as X-rays to examine the anatomy and performance of joints, delivering a complete understanding of the condition.

Are There Other Therapies for Hip Dysplasia?

Alternative methods for hip dysplasia include acupuncture, physical therapy, and chiropractic adjustments. Additionally, supplements like glucosamine and omega-3 fatty acids may help relieve pain and optimize mobility, supporting overall joint health in affected dogs.

What Is the Length of life of a Dog With Hip Dysplasia?

A canine with hip dysplasia can live a typical lifespan, usually 10 to 15 years, based on factors such as severity, treatment, and general health status. Control through diet, exercise, and veterinary support greatly influences how long they survive.
